Materials and Durability: What to Expect Under $20
When shopping for girls’ drop earrings under $20, it’s important to have realistic expectations about the materials and durability. At this price point, you’re unlikely to find precious metals like gold or sterling silver. Instead, expect to encounter base metals such as brass, zinc alloy, or stainless steel. These metals are often plated with a thin layer of gold, silver, or rhodium to enhance their appearance and prevent tarnishing, although this plating may wear off over time with frequent use.
The quality of the plating can vary significantly. Look for earrings advertised as having a thicker plating or a protective coating, as this will help extend their lifespan. Similarly, the stones or embellishments used in these earrings are likely to be cubic zirconia, crystals, glass beads, or acrylic gems rather than genuine diamonds or precious stones. These materials can still be beautiful and sparkling, but they may not have the same brilliance or durability as their more expensive counterparts.
Durability is another crucial factor to consider. Earrings in this price range may be more prone to breakage or bending, especially if they are delicate or feature intricate designs. Encourage careful handling and proper storage to prolong their life. Avoid exposing them to harsh chemicals, such as chlorine or cleaning products, as these can damage the plating and affect the appearance of the stones.
Despite the potential limitations of the materials used, many affordable drop earrings can be surprisingly well-made and long-lasting if cared for properly. Read product reviews carefully to get an idea of the experiences of other customers and look for earrings that appear to be sturdily constructed. Understanding the trade-offs between price and quality will help you make an informed decision and choose earrings that offer the best value for your money.
Safety Considerations for Young Wearers
Ensuring the safety of girls’ drop earrings is paramount, especially when considering younger wearers. One of the most important aspects is to confirm that the earrings are hypoallergenic. This typically means avoiding nickel, a common metal allergen. Earrings labeled as “nickel-free” are ideal, although it’s always wise to double-check the material composition. Allergic reactions to jewelry can manifest as skin irritation, redness, itching, or even blisters.
Another safety concern is the size and design of the earrings. Avoid earrings with small, detachable parts that could pose a choking hazard if swallowed. Opt for earrings with secure clasps or closures to prevent them from falling off and potentially being ingested. The length of the drop should also be considered. Extra-long earrings might be easily snagged or pulled, which could be uncomfortable or even dangerous.
Weight is another factor to keep in mind. Heavy earrings can put strain on the earlobes, potentially causing discomfort or stretching. Lightweight materials and designs are preferable, especially for younger girls who may not be accustomed to wearing earrings regularly. Consider the activity level of the wearer. For active girls who participate in sports or other physical activities, smaller, more secure earrings are the safest choice.
Always supervise young children when they are wearing earrings, especially if they are new to wearing jewelry. Educate them about the importance of handling earrings carefully and avoiding pulling or tugging on them. Regularly inspect the earrings for any signs of damage or wear and tear, and replace them if necessary. Prioritizing safety will ensure that wearing drop earrings is a fun and enjoyable experience for girls of all ages.
Care and Maintenance Tips for Affordable Jewelry
Proper care and maintenance are crucial for extending the lifespan of affordable girls’ drop earrings. Since these earrings are often made from plated metals, the plating can wear off over time if not properly cared for. One of the most important tips is to avoid exposing the earrings to harsh chemicals, such as chlorine, cleaning products, or perfumes. These chemicals can damage the plating and cause discoloration.
When not being worn, store the earrings in a clean, dry place, ideally in a jewelry box or pouch. This will help protect them from scratches, dust, and moisture. Avoid storing them in humid environments, such as bathrooms, as moisture can accelerate tarnishing. Separate earrings from other jewelry to prevent them from scratching each other. Consider using small resealable plastic bags to store each pair individually.
To clean the earrings, use a soft, lint-free cloth to gently wipe away any dirt or debris.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ads, as these can scratch the surface of the earrings. For more stubborn dirt, you can use a mild soap and water solution. Dip a soft cloth into the solution and gently wipe the earrings, then rinse them thoroughly with clean water and pat them dry.
Regularly inspect the earrings for any loose stones or clasps. If you notice any damage, it’s best to repair it as soon as possible to prevent further damage. While professional jewelry repair may not be cost-effective for earrings in this price range, you can often make simple repairs yourself using jewelry pliers and glue. By following these simple care and maintenance tips, you can help keep your girls’ drop earrings looking their best for longer.

Material & Sensitivity Considerations
The material composition of earrings is paramount, particularly when purchasing for girls who often have more sensitive skin. Nickel, a common component in inexpensive alloys, is a notorious allergen, leading to contact dermatitis in a significant portion of the population. Studies have shown that up to 17% of women and 3% of men are sensitive to nickel. Earrings containing high levels of nickel can trigger itching, redness, and even blisters around the earlobe. Therefore, opting for hypoallergenic materials such as stainless steel, sterling silver (although care should be taken to verify the silver is authentic and not heavily alloyed), or surgical steel is highly recommended. Look for products explicitly labeled “nickel-free” or “hypoallergenic” to minimize the risk of adverse reactions.
Beyond nickel, other potential irritants include lead and cadmium, which are sometimes found in cheaper imported jewelry. Reputable manufacturers will adhere to safety standards and regulations, such as those set by the Consumer Product Safety Improvement Act (CPSIA), which limits the amount of lead permissible in children’s products. While finding detailed material composition reports for inexpensive earrings may be challenging, prioritize vendors with transparent practices and positive customer reviews regarding skin sensitivity. Look for visual cues like a clear, shiny finish (indicating better plating quality) and avoid pieces with obvious discoloration or rough edges, which could indicate poor material quality and potential for irritation. Ultimately, erring on the side of caution and choosing simpler designs with fewer added elements minimizes the potential for allergic reactions and discomfort.

Durability & Closure Security
Durability is a crucial factor when considering the lifespan of the best girls drop earrings under $20. Children are naturally more active and less careful with their belongings, so earrings must be able to withstand everyday wear and tear. Look for earrings with sturdy construction, well-attached components, and secure closures. Weak joints or flimsy materials are prone to breakage, rendering the earrings unusable and potentially creating a safety hazard.
The type of earring closure significantly impacts its security and ease of use. Common closure types include butterfly backs, lever backs, and fish hooks. Butterfly backs are widely used but can be easily lost or loosened over time. Lever backs provide a more secure closure, as they latch firmly onto the post. Fish hooks are simple but can be easily dislodged, especially during active play. Consider the child’s dexterity and age when choosing a closure type. For younger children, lever backs or screw backs (though less common in drop earrings) offer the best security. Inspect the closure mechanism carefully before purchase, ensuring it is easy to open and close but also holds securely. Reading customer reviews that specifically address the durability and closure security of the earrings can provide valuable real-world feedback. Prioritizing durability and secure closures will prevent accidental loss and ensure the earrings can be enjoyed for a longer period.

What are the best materials for girls’ earrings, considering both price and sensitivity?
For girls’ earrings that balance affordability and sensitivity, stainless steel and sterling silver are excellent choices. Stainless steel is a durable, hypoallergenic material that resists tarnishing and is generally very affordable. Surgical stainless steel, in particular, is a grade known for its low nickel content, making it suitable for many with sensitivities. It offers a sleek, modern look and is available in various styles.
Sterling silver, composed of 92.5% silver and 7.5% other metals (usually copper), offers a classic and elegant aesthetic. While slightly more expensive than stainless steel, it’s still often available under the $20 price point. Ensure that the sterling silver earrings are rhodium-plated. Rhodium plating provides a protective layer that minimizes tarnishing and further reduces the risk of allergic reactions by creating a barrier between the silver and the skin. Both materials provide a safe and stylish option.

What are some age-appropriate drop earring styles for girls?
Age-appropriate drop earring styles for girls vary depending on the child’s age and maturity. For younger girls (ages 3-7), consider small, lightweight drops with whimsical designs like animals, flowers, or stars. These should be simple and securely fastened to prevent loss or accidental removal. Avoid earrings with sharp edges or dangling parts that could pose a safety hazard.
As girls get older (ages 8-12), they may appreciate more sophisticated styles, such as small hoops, simple pearl drops, or delicate charms. Teardrop shapes and subtle geometric designs can also be suitable. For teenagers (ages 13+), the options expand significantly to include longer drops, more elaborate designs, and bolder colors. However, it’s still important to consider the individual’s personal style and comfort level. Always ensure that the earrings are not overly heavy or distracting, and that they comply with any school dress codes.
